What are the responsibilities and job description for the Executive Administrative Assistant position at MS Shift, Inc.?
The Executive Administrative Assistant provides high-level administrative, operational, and strategic support to C-level executives. This role ensures the executive office runs smoothly by managing schedules, coordinating high-priority initiatives, preparing communications, and serving as a trusted gatekeeper and liaison across internal teams and external partners.
The ideal candidate is proactive, highly organized, tech-savvy, professional, resourceful, and able to manage competing priorities in a fast-paced, high-growth environment.
Key Responsibilities
Executive Support
- Manage complex calendars, coordinate meetings, and optimize scheduling across global time zones.
- Prepare executives for meetings by organizing agendas, briefing documents, and follow-up notes.
- Handle confidential information with discretion.
- Arrange domestic and international travel, itineraries, accommodations, and expense reports.
- Monitor and triage emails, messages, and requests on behalf of executives.
Operations & Project Coordination
- Support execution of strategic initiatives and cross-functional projects.
- Track deadlines, deliverables, and priorities for the executive team.
- Draft, edit, and organize presentations, reports, and dashboards.
- Assist with onboarding of new hires into the executive department.
Communication & Liaison
- Serve as a communication bridge between executives and internal teams, clients, and external stakeholders.
- Draft professional emails, memos, announcements, and correspondence.
- Maintain strong working relationships across all departments.
Administrative Excellence
- Maintain organized digital filing systems, documents, and shared drives.
- Coordinate board meetings, leadership offsites, and major company events.
- Handle procurement of office supplies, software subscriptions, and executive tools.
- Create and maintain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) for the executive office.
